Role overview
Ampol is looking for a retail team member to join the Warners Bay store. The role sits within one of Australia’s major convenience retail networks, where the focus is on helping customers quickly and courteously whether they are purchasing fuel, picking up everyday items, or making a brief stop.
What you will be doing
In this position, you will help keep the store running smoothly by supporting merchandising standards, managing stock, and assisting with inventory control. You will also process sales through the POS system and complete cash balancing at the end of each shift with accuracy and care.
Core duties
- Provide helpful, friendly service that aims to go beyond customer expectations.
- Assist the store manager with day-to-day retail operations.
- Work cooperatively with the wider team to maintain an efficient store environment.
- Maintain strong focus on safety, accuracy, and attention to detail.
- Work flexible hours, including weekends and overnight shifts when required.
Skills and experience
The ideal candidate will have prior exposure to retail or customer service, along with the ability to use point-of-sale systems and manage cash correctly. Good communication skills, a team-first attitude, and flexibility to work across a seven-day roster are important for success in this role.
